Overview Ketorol Injection
Ketorol Injection provides rapid relief from moderate to severe pain, temporarily reducing inflammation and fever. This injectable medication is unsuitable for mild pain or prolonged pain management and is reserved for situations where oral medication is impractical. Administration must be performed by a qualified healthcare professional; self-injection is strictly prohibited. Patients with a history of heart conditions or stroke should inform their physician before use. Report any injection site reactions, such as redness, swelling, or soreness, immediately. While nausea and headache are frequently reported, other potential side effects include gastrointestinal upset (including abdominal pain, constipation, diarrhea, and indigestion), impaired kidney function, anemia, dizziness, drowsiness, swelling, and skin rashes. For extended treatment, close monitoring of kidney and liver function, along with blood counts, is necessary. Prolonged use carries a risk of serious complications, including gastrointestinal bleeding and kidney damage.

Common Side effects of Ketorol Injection:
- Nausea
- Vomiting
- Stomach pain/epigastric pain
- Diarrhea
- Heartburn
- Loss of appetite
- Indigestion
- Rash

S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holCAUTION
Use caution when combining Ketorol Injection and alcohol. Seek medical advice before doing so.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The use of Ketorol Injection during pregnancy may pose risks. While human research is scarce, animal studies indicate potential harm to the fetus. A physician will assess the advantages against possible dangers prior to prescription. Seek medical advice.
Breast feedingCAUTION
Administering Ketorol Injection to breastfeeding mothers requires careful consideration. Lactation should be temporarily discontinued throughout the mother's treatment and until the medication is fully cleared from her system.
DrivingUNSAFE
Administering Ketorol Injection may impair driving ability due to potential adverse reactions.
KidneyCAUTION
Patients with impaired kidney function should use Ketorol Injection judiciously. Dosage modification may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
LiverCAUTION
Patients with hepatic impairment should use Ketorol Injection cautiously, potentially requiring a modified dosage. Physician consultation is advised.
